Good Friday Quiet Space

In Lanark there is a good tradition of the churches working together to promote a unified message, particularly throughout the Christian seasons. This Easter saw 10,000 colour postcards delivered to every home in the town advertising our services and inviting people to come to church and share in worship and fellowship.

One new idea for 2009 was the opening of the churches on Good Friday. Each church opened for an hour and provided a space for reflection and prayer. in Greyfriars, we provided different prayer stations for people to think about the journey of Jesus in that last week of his life on earth. It was extremely worthwhile for those who came along and took time to reflect and pause with their thoughts.
